When I was co-op engineer in college, we used these terminals.  Ours were the version with two tape drives.  The application was to generate configurations for microwave relay system racks.  One drive would prompt the operator for various options.  The responses were written to the second drive.  That tape would then be downloaded to a Univac 1108 mainframe that would punch a card deck that was sent to an IBM mainframe that produced another card deck of all the parts that would be needed to build the system.

The problem was that if any operator errors or bad or conflicting entries were done, the whole process would have to be repeated.   It could take an engineer a week to generate a valid rack configuration.  So, I changed the program (without asking anybody) to skip the tape drive step and do an interactive configuration dialog with instantaneous error checking and punch the first deck directly.  It reduced the time to generate a valid (and error-free) configuration to under 30 minutes.

Another change was to read the parts database directly.  The original programs would query the database in a way that simulated reading punch cards... which the Univac charged around 25 cents per "card."  I changed the way the data base was read which bypassed the card charge (which could be around 1000 "cards" per rack. 

Surprisingly management was rather furious, but got over it after realizing the savings and god-like praise from the configuration engineers.   Over several years there was not a single report of the system generating a bad rack configuration (and anybody collecting the bounty offered for finding a bug that would generate an improper configuration)... it saved the company millions of dollars.

The slow mode was 110 bps, for compatibility with the dominant ASR33 of the day. The models with an RS232C socket on the back worked up to 1200bps on that port. The acoustic modem was limited to 300bps.

The "here is" key sent a break - basically a UART framing error, which the receiving end would register without decoding the serial stream, and wake up.

The version in the picture with 2 cassette tape drives was one of the mainstays of early microprocessor system development. We used them a lot when developing assembly language code, before people like Intel and Motorola got their 8" floppy disk based development systems working.

Gather around the campfire boys and girls while Grampa explains what they are good for.  You see with the wipers oriented in the 'wrong' way they are the only sockets into which you can plug a 3M ZiF socket directly, without bother. Well there is a small amount of effort as you have to remove the plastic top cover of the TI socket with your fingernail or exacto knife.
You see the ZiF socket pins are also oriented-flat in the wrong way. Match made in heaven, the 3M sockets  fit snug. They can not be plugged into a machine pin socket which was always my first choice in sockets..

You need a (TI) socket like this if you are making a DIY eprom programmer and want a simple and convenient way to connect the ZiF socket pins to the underlying circuit through an enclosed case. What you do is solder the TI socket to your board in such a way that the top sits just proud of the surface of your case. Then you just plug the ZiF socket into that after the case is assembled. Neat and easy-peasy. This is useless knowledge now that the TI sockets are unobtainium. |O

According to the manual the HERE-IS key transmits the contents of the optional answer-back memory. Maybe that is the empty socket.
That's correct! This was used to identify the location of the connected teletype ("Building 100, terminal pool 6") in response to a ^E from the host. This could also be used to tell the host something about the terminal's capabilities (later, the ANSI X3.64 standard supported specific capability information).

Dave, you didn't mention the real reason that acoustic couplers were used. In the 1960s, there were no standard modular phone connectors, and the only devices that could legally be connected to the phone system were rented by the phone company (including phones, special multiline systems, and modems, all of which were billed at monthly rates). It was only after the Carterfone decision that you could privately own a modem electrically connected to the network.

Surely you mean DA15?  The 2nd letter is the case size, so in the 'normal' dual row config D shell connectors are:
DE9
DA15
DB25
DC37
DD50
Also, IIRC it's 20mA loop, and not RS-232.  Yes you read that right, it pre-dates RS-232 !!!!!

As for the "Here Is" key, it sends the programmed answerback, which can also be sent by the remote side sending a Control-E (ENQ - Enquire).  It was a cheap/easy way for a remote side to detect a device, or send perhaps a short loginID or something like that.  Terminals like the VT100 also had a builtin answerback (which we would abuse in college by setting it to "^log^m").  That empty socket is for a PROM it would be burned onto. 


FAST = 300 baud = 30 characters/sec of (start + 8 data + stop)
SLOW = 110 baud = 10 characters/sec of (start + 8 data + 2 stop)
and the 8 data could be 7 data+parity

I last used one of these in the mid 1980s, it was still the cheapest, most portable printer you could find.  Sure an LA120 was faster, but it was huge, and decidedly non-portable.
